Johanan ben Joiada was the Jewish High Priest, from 410 BCE to 371 BCE.

Overview

Johanan ben Joiada was a member of the House of Zadok. He ruled as High Priest, from 410 BCE (after his father Joiada), to 371 BCE (followed by his son Jaddua).
